世纪无核葡萄在民勤“棚中棚”栽培越冬试验初报

摘  要:经过4年对引进国外葡萄优良品种世纪(森田尼)无核在民勤荒漠区进行栽培试验,结果表明,在冬季外界最低气温-27.0℃以下,搭建"棚中棚"双层膜保护条件下最低气温在-8.0℃以上,葡萄植株可安全越冬。春季萌发时间晚于日光温室种植而早于露天种植,填补了温室种植和露天种植之间的葡萄成熟期时间空间,建立了"棚中棚"葡萄自有时空的市场域。同时,世纪无核品种"棚中棚"葡萄安全越冬保护性种植技术比常规单膜拱棚平均每年节约成本18%;该"棚中棚"和常规太阳能温室种植比较,可节约成本30%,比当地露天相同面积同龄葡萄园产值高6倍多,经济效益非常显著。在民勤荒漠绿洲区及同类地区具有较好的推广价值。Cultivation experiment was conducted on the introduction of foreign grape(Vitaceae vitisl) fine vari-eties of centennial seedless in the desert areas of Minqin for four years,the results showed that the minimum tempera-ture was below-27.0 ℃ in outside of winter,and the shed membrane protective layer under the conditions of outside during the winter minimum temperature of above-8.0 ℃,grape plants can live though the winter safely.Its spring ger-mination time was later than in sunlight greenhouse plant by but it was earlier than in the open air.Compared to green-house cultivation,it has the trend of 30 d delay maturity;and compared to cultivation in the open air,it has the trend of significantly earlier 35 d maturity.To fill the greenhouse and open field cultivation of grapes between the maturity time and space.The establishment of a "shed roof" grape market its own space-time domain.Meanwhile,seedless variety "shed roof" on winter protection of grape cultivation technology than the conventional single-film shed average annual cost savings of 18%;the "studio in the shed" and the more conventional solar greenhouse can cost 30% the same area of the same age than the local open-air high six times and the value of the vineyard,economic benefit is very signifi-cant.Minqin desert oasis and similar regions have a better spread value.
